Job Description Job Description Summary: The Program Specialist
provides direct, non-therapeutic services for the Child Abuse
Prevention Program (CAPP) and works closely with other program
staff and/or volunteers. Essential Functions Completes specific
program assignments, including but not limited to: Deliver program
presentations to students, parents, and teachers in school and
community-based settings. Assists with the development and updating
of program materials. Assists with program related correspondence
about activities. Completes assigned program documentation
accurately and on-time. Delivers presentations both in-person and
virtually. Receives disclosures of child abuse or neglect and
reports disclosures as necessary. Performs other duties as required
or assigned Complies with all company policies and standards.
Qualifications To be successful in this position, an individual
must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The
requirements listed above are representative of the knowledge,
skills and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be
made to enable individuals with varying abilities to perform the
essential functions. Education: Bachelor’s degree Work Experience:
One year of experience in program area. Knowledge, Skills and
Abilities Ability to analyze/solve problems and communicate
recommendations. Advanced presentation skills Ability to
communicate information calmly in high-stress situations,
demonstrating sensitivity to the population being served (elderly,
teachers, young students, and adults/families dealing with severe
mental illness). Ability to use general office equipment,
computers, and related software programs. Demonstrates teamwork and
support of the JFS mission and values. Licenses, Certifications and
Professional Affiliations: N/A Supervisory Responsibilities: N/A
Work Environment Work is typically performed in an office
environment, employee’s home, or in a school/camp setting. Physical
Demands This position requires prolonged periods of sitting at a
desk and working on a computer. The position may require standing
for more than an hour at a time. At times, staff must transport
heavy portfolios and paperwork weighing as much as 50 pounds. The
potential exists for highly stressful and emotionally-charged
encounters with clients and/or family members. Travel Will require
travel to schools, camps, other agencies/organizations. Programs
are presented throughout the St. Louis Metropolitan area, as well
as, outlying areas, leading to substantial travel requirements that
may exceed 50% of time. Must have access to private, reliable
